  44. package org.eclipse.jgit.treewalk;
  45. import static org.junit.Assert.assertEquals;
  46. import org.eclipse.jgit.dircache.DirCache;
  47. import org.eclipse.jgit.dircache.DirCacheBuilder;
  48. import org.eclipse.jgit.dircache.DirCacheEntry;
  49. import org.eclipse.jgit.junit.RepositoryTestCase;
  50. import org.eclipse.jgit.lib.FileMode;
  51. import org.eclipse.jgit.lib.ObjectId;
  52. import org.eclipse.jgit.lib.ObjectInserter;
  53. import org.eclipse.jgit.lib.ObjectReader;
  54. import org.junit.Test;
  55. public class ForPathTest extends RepositoryTestCase {
  56. private static final FileMode SYMLINK = FileMode.SYMLINK;
  57. private static final FileMode REGULAR_FILE = FileMode.REGULAR_FILE;
  58. private static final FileMode EXECUTABLE_FILE = FileMode.EXECUTABLE_FILE;
  59. @Test
  60. public void testFindObjects() throws Exception {
  61. final DirCache tree0 = DirCache.newInCore();
  62. final DirCacheBuilder b0 = tree0.builder();
  63. try (ObjectReader or = db.newObjectReader();
  64. ObjectInserter oi = db.newObjectInserter()) {
  65. DirCacheEntry aDotB = createEntry("a.b", EXECUTABLE_FILE);
  66. b0.add(aDotB);
  67. DirCacheEntry aSlashB = createEntry("a/b", REGULAR_FILE);
  68. b0.add(aSlashB);
  69. DirCacheEntry aSlashCSlashD = createEntry("a/c/d", REGULAR_FILE);
  70. b0.add(aSlashCSlashD);
  71. DirCacheEntry aZeroB = createEntry("a0b", SYMLINK);
  72. b0.add(aZeroB);
  73. b0.finish();
  74. assertEquals(4, tree0.getEntryCount());
  75. ObjectId tree = tree0.writeTree(oi);
  76. // Find the directories that were implicitly created above.
  77. ObjectId a = null;
  78. ObjectId aSlashC = null;
  79. try (TreeWalk tw = new TreeWalk(or)) {
  80. tw.addTree(tree);
  81. while (tw.next()) {
  82. if (tw.getPathString().equals("a")) {
  83. a = tw.getObjectId(0);
  84. tw.enterSubtree();
  85. while (tw.next()) {
  86. if (tw.getPathString().equals("a/c")) {
  87. aSlashC = tw.getObjectId(0);
  88. break;
  89. }
  90. }
  91. break;
  92. }
  93. }
  94. }
  95. assertEquals(a, TreeWalk.forPath(or, "a", tree).getObjectId(0));
  96. assertEquals(a, TreeWalk.forPath(or, "a/", tree).getObjectId(0));
  97. assertEquals(null, TreeWalk.forPath(or, "/a", tree));
  98. assertEquals(null, TreeWalk.forPath(or, "/a/", tree));
  99. assertEquals(aDotB.getObjectId(),
  100. TreeWalk.forPath(or, "a.b", tree).getObjectId(0));
  101. assertEquals(null, TreeWalk.forPath(or, "/a.b", tree));
  102. assertEquals(null, TreeWalk.forPath(or, "/a.b/", tree));
  103. assertEquals(aDotB.getObjectId(),
  104. TreeWalk.forPath(or, "a.b/", tree).getObjectId(0));
  105. assertEquals(aZeroB.getObjectId(),
  106. TreeWalk.forPath(or, "a0b", tree).getObjectId(0));
  107. assertEquals(aSlashB.getObjectId(),
  108. TreeWalk.forPath(or, "a/b", tree).getObjectId(0));
  109. assertEquals(aSlashB.getObjectId(),
  110. TreeWalk.forPath(or, "b", a).getObjectId(0));
  111. assertEquals(aSlashC,
  112. TreeWalk.forPath(or, "a/c", tree).getObjectId(0));
  113. assertEquals(aSlashC, TreeWalk.forPath(or, "c", a).getObjectId(0));
  114. assertEquals(aSlashCSlashD.getObjectId(),
  115. TreeWalk.forPath(or, "a/c/d", tree).getObjectId(0));
  116. assertEquals(aSlashCSlashD.getObjectId(),
  117. TreeWalk.forPath(or, "c/d", a).getObjectId(0));
  118. }
  119. }
  120. }
